Defining Sales Acceleration for B2B Growth
Sales acceleration represents a strategic approach designed to rapidly propel potential customers through the sales pipeline by leveraging advanced technologies, data-driven insights, and refined methodologies. At its core, sales acceleration transforms traditional sales processes into dynamic, intelligent systems that enhance conversion rates and optimise revenue generation. By integrating sophisticated tools and strategic frameworks, organisations can systematically reduce sales cycle complexity and improve overall performance.
In the complex landscape of B2B sales, acceleration goes beyond simple speed improvements. It encompasses a holistic methodology that synchronises people, processes, and technologies to create more efficient revenue generation mechanisms. Modern sales acceleration strategies focus on three critical dimensions: intelligent prospect targeting, streamlined engagement workflows, and data-powered decision-making. These strategies enable sales teams to move beyond reactive approaches, instead proactively identifying and nurturing high-potential opportunities with unprecedented precision.
The fundamental components of effective sales acceleration include advanced qualification techniques, intelligent pipeline management, and sophisticated engagement technologies. Sales teams utilising these strategies can significantly reduce friction in the buying process, build stronger client relationships, and create more predictable revenue streams. By embracing a comprehensive approach that combines strategic insights with technological capabilities, organisations can transform their sales performance and achieve sustainable growth in increasingly competitive markets.

Sales Acceleration Tools and Technologies
Sales acceleration technologies represent a sophisticated ecosystem of integrated tools designed to transform how organisations approach revenue generation. Sales technology platforms enable teams to predict future sales growth through advanced multivariable analysis, incorporating critical data points such as sales cycle duration, opportunity characteristics, and individual representative performance metrics. These intelligent systems go beyond traditional customer relationship management by providing real-time insights and predictive capabilities that fundamentally reshape sales strategies.
The core technological components of sales acceleration include comprehensive lead management solutions that streamline critical processes. Advanced tools offer capabilities such as intelligent lead qualification, automated lead scoring, sophisticated routing mechanisms, and in-depth buyer research functionalities. These technologies dramatically reduce manual administrative tasks, allowing sales professionals to focus their energy on high-value engagement activities. Automated systems provide real-time alerts, email tracking capabilities, and granular analytics that enable teams to make data-driven decisions with unprecedented precision.

Common Pitfalls and How to Avoid Them
Sales acceleration initiatives frequently encounter systemic challenges that can undermine their effectiveness, requiring strategic foresight and careful implementation. Identifying common sales mistakes becomes crucial for organisations seeking to develop robust, sustainable revenue generation strategies. Technological overreliance represents one of the most significant pitfalls, where teams mistakenly believe sophisticated tools can entirely replace human relationship-building and nuanced strategic thinking.
Organisations often struggle with three primary implementation challenges in sales acceleration. First, inadequate change management can lead to poor technological adoption, with sales teams resisting new systems and processes. Second, insufficient data integration creates siloed information that prevents holistic performance insights. Third, organisations frequently fail to align their sales acceleration strategies with broader strategic objectives, resulting in fragmented and ineffective approaches that generate minimal tangible improvements.
Successful mitigation of these pitfalls requires a comprehensive, balanced approach that emphasises human expertise alongside technological innovation. Sales leaders must prioritise comprehensive training programmes, ensure seamless technological integration, and maintain a flexible mindset that allows continuous refinement of acceleration strategies. By developing a culture of adaptability, investing in ongoing skills development, and creating transparent, collaborative systems that empower sales professionals, organisations can transform potential obstacles into opportunities for sustainable growth and performance enhancement.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is sales acceleration?
Sales acceleration refers to a strategic approach that aims to speed up the sales process by using advanced technologies, data-driven insights, and refined methodologies to improve conversion rates and revenue generation.
What are the key components of effective sales acceleration?
Key components include advanced qualification techniques, intelligent pipeline management, and sophisticated engagement technologies that work together to enhance the efficiency and predictability of revenue generation processes.
How does sales acceleration benefit B2B organisations?
Sales acceleration improves lead generation efficiency, reduces time spent on low-potential prospects, and enables sales teams to focus on high-value relationship-building activities, ultimately creating a more responsive sales environment.
What are common pitfalls in sales acceleration implementation?
Common pitfalls include technological overreliance, inadequate change management, and insufficient data integration, which can undermine the effectiveness of sales acceleration initiatives.
